I know this is super late, but from at least one policy direct from the AI people

Can applicants opt out of having their resume reviewed by Candidate Relevancy? What happens if someone opts out?

All applicants are included in the applicant queue for a recruiter to review. Individuals applying through ADP’s recruiting platforms can choose not to have their application reviewed by Candidate Relevancy or Profile Relevancy tools. Each opt-out choice is job-specific and opts the candidate out for the specific job posting only. For applicants who have chosen to opt out, their score will be listed as “Not Available,” which is the same indicator used if a relevancy score is unavailable for reasons other than opt-out (e.g., technical issues, poor resolution on resume pdf, etc.).
